    The Book of Joe: Milwaukee Brewers Manager Pat Murphy

    The Book of Joe: Milwaukee Brewers Manager Pat Murphy

    The Book of Joe Podcast with hosts Tom Verducci and Joe Maddon welcomes newly named Milwaukee Brewers manager Pat Murphy.  Pat talks about getting the job and how he made his way to the majors.  After being a player/manager in the minors, Pat explains how he started out being very tough on players but then truly learned how to manage a team.  Tom and Joe ask about this Brewers team and the direction they're headed for next season.  We close out with how Pat will feel facing off against some of his former players, who are now managers as well.

    Transitioning from MLB to Entrepreneurship & Philanthropy with Willie Bloomquist

    Transitioning from MLB to Entrepreneurship & Philanthropy with Willie Bloomquist

    Willie Bloomquist is a former MLB player, entrepreneur, and philanthropist. Throughout his career in baseball, Willie played for the Seattle Mariners, Kansas City Royals, Cincinnati Reds, and Arizona Diamondbacks, and has played every position aside from catcher and pitcher. After retiring from professional sports in 2016, Willie explored his other passions through the avenues of entrepreneurship and philanthropy. His passion for nature led to his founding Elite Outdoor Adventures, a company which “allows you to spend one-on-one time with a professional athlete or celebrity participating in a pastime that you both enjoy.”

    Listen in as Willie discusses his journey as a professional athlete and why he decided to turn to entrepreneurship following his retirement from MLB. He also shares his love for the outdoors and the business that resulted from that passion. Finally, Willie talks charity and outreach and why philanthropy has become a huge priority in his life.
